    Japanese food wasn’t always seen as belonging on the same fine dining stage as other foods in Chicago, which is why Arami’s 14-year run in West Town has been remarkable, coinciding with how the perceptions of Americans have changed. As one of the first restaurants along a stretch of Chicago Avenue now crowded with restaurants, Ty and brother Troy Fujimura’s restaurants set a standard with hot and cold options with top-notch sushi, noodles, and skewers.

    That run will close at the end of August as Arami’s final service will come on Saturday, August 31. Fujimura says he notified his workers on Wednesday, August 14.

    “We struggle like any other restaurant — especially a small restaurant — and [it’s hard to] kind of make ends meet without having to compromise,” Ty Fujimura says. “So we’re in that position now where I think the restaurant, I know the restaurant has run its course.”

    There’s a pattern for the Fujimuras who earlier this year sold his first restaurant, SmallBar, in Logan Square. There are personal and family struggles that Ty Fujumura didn’t want to share. Despite the support of regulars, Arami has struggled since the pandemic began in 2020. Chef Joe Fontelera departed to pursue his dream of spotlighting Filipino food and opening Boonie’s Filipino Restaurant. Not that scrambling was anything new for Arami. Two years in, opening chef and partner BK Park left the restaurant abruptly in 2012 (he would later open Juno in Lincoln Park). The Fujimuras closed the restaurant for two weeks to reload. In 2016, a fire kept the restaurant closed for a month. Even more recently, the Fujimuras brought back a fan favorite rehiring chef Nelson Vinansaca, their former sushi chef who moved to Ecuador five years ago. Vinansaca brought stability, but apparently, it hasn’t been enough.

    Fujumura says if anyone is interested in buying a turnkey restaurant, he’d be interested in selling the business. But right now, he feels a sense of relief. Arami could also be considered a pioneer as one of the first upscale restaurants on a stretch of Chicago Avenue that now includes Brasero, Forbidden Root, All Together Now, and more. Fujimura says he’s been wrestling with the decision to close the former Michelin Bib Gourmand staple for about a month.

    “It might sound weird, but I’m really happy — I’m happy because now we have time to celebrate,” Ty Fujimura says. “We can celebrate this restaurant with our friends and our family. You know past employees, people that haven’t been there yet. — there are so many experiences that people have shared there whether it’s memories made for birthdays, anniversaries, or what have you.”

    The restaurant opened just before sushi omakase became trendy and has hosted several celebrities including Blackhawk players, musicians, and actors. It was also where sports reporter Darren Rovell complained about surcharges.

    “I’ve been waffling back and forth… I could restructure my lease and maybe do a little fund raise, and do some changes at the restaurant,” he says. “But you know what? That sounds like I’m rescuing this restaurant. The restaurant doesn’t need to be rescued. This restaurant needs to be retired,”

    Fujumura has been reexamining his role in the restaurant industry. He remains a partner at Lilac Tiger, the reimagined Wazwan in Wicker Park with food from James Beard Award nominee Zubair Mohajir. Midway International Airport still has an Arami location, and he’s hopeful of opening one at O’Hare International Airport. His company, Fujimura Hospitality, runs the food service at the Chicago Corinthian Yacht Club at Montrose Harbor, and he runs Rockwell Bottle Shop in Lincoln Square. But it’s been challenging during the pandemic. He swung hard and relocated Michelin-starred Entented from Lincoln Square to a new space in River North. Pandemic-era dining restrictions crushed the restaurant which has since closed and is now home to Obelix.

    “After doing this now for well over two decades, it’s that time to catch your breath, that time to be in your own element, and inside your head… those times are far and few in between,” Fujimura says. “I feel no one’s going to give me that, no one’s going to make that time for me — I need to make that time for myself.”

    Arami, 1629 W. Chicago Avenue, closing Saturday, August 31.

    A storied space in Hyde Park has welcomed a new indulgent all-day affair featuring Southern-style breakfast and brunch. Dawn opened in late January in the former home of Italian institution Piccolo Mondo. It’s the second Hyde Park venture from Chicago native Racquel Fields, owner of 14 Parish.

    Dawn delivers playful spins on Southern staples like juicy pot roast with jalapeño cheddar cheese grits and cornbread French toast with a fried chicken thigh and spiced peach compote. An ode to Fields’ childhood at her great-grandmother’s house in Englewood.

    “Dawn is actually kind of [a] time capsule from my own family,” says Fields. “It gives and pays respect in so many elements. There are a lot of bird motifs because we called my mother’s mother ‘Bird,’ [as in] ‘You came to visit the old bird.”

    Dawn owner Racquel Fields.

    Fields has deftly woven references to her ancestors into the food menu and 131-seat space. Her Louisiana-born maternal grandfather, for example, is the motivation behind Fields’ spin on the classic po’boy (Clee’s Rich Lad) stuffed with Cajun grilled shrimp and andouille chicken sausage. Her paternal grandmother, who died when Fields was a child, is honored by a prominent sculptural light fixture that resembles a long string of pearls with gold beads in between — an oversized replica of a real necklace left behind after her death.

    The restaurant, for Fields, represents more than morning meals — it’s about all types of comfort, whether that looks like brunch with relatives, after-work cocktails, or a cup of coffee. And Dawn doesn’t skimp on style. “I wanted Dawn to feel like… a rich auntie’s house,” she says, laughing. “It’s retro-esque but doesn’t feel old.”

    Fields, who also owns Caribbean dining and drinking spot 14 Parish, sees Dawn as a kind of second act — an opportunity to show how much she’s learned about hospitality since founding her first restaurant in 2017.

    “[Dawn] is the second coming of 14 Parish,” she says. “I picked every nail head, every piece of trim, every menu item. It challenged me to stretch as a restaurateur. I hope it speaks to the community and helps them reconnect with those experiences from their childhood.”

    According to Visited, the most popular castle destinations around the globe are:

    1. Prague Castle is the most visited castle in the world. The massive complex is the largest castle in Europe and dates back to the 9th century.
    2. Château de Versailles or the Palace of Versailles is a grandiose castle outside of Paris that features ornate and lavish architecture and impeccable gardens. 
    3. Edinburgh Castle is the top tourist attraction in Scotland. The palace houses the Crown Jewels of Scotland and dates back to the 12th century.
    4. Windsor Castle is the oldest and largest occupied castle in the world. England’s royal families have lived in the countryside castle for over 1,000 years. 
    5. Schonbrunn Palace is a UNESCO World Heritage Site in Austria that once housed the Habsburg monarchs.
    6. Neuschwanstein Castle is a Bavarian cliffside castle with a fairy tale-esque style in Germany.
    7. Mont-Saint Michel includes an abbey and monastery with medieval architecture. 
    8. Alhambra in Granada, Spain, includes Islamic architecture that dates back to the 12th century.
    9. Prince’s Palace of Monaco blends Baroque and Renaissance architecture. The Monaco Palace is home to Prince Rainier’s son and successor Prince Albert II.
    10. The Royal Castle in Warsaw was the official residence of Polish monarchies and is a state museum and a national historical monument.

    These are the top 10 most popular statues in the world to visit, according to Visited:

    1. Statue of Liberty is the most visited statue in the world. 
    2. Charging Bull – or the Bull of Wall Street – is an iconic bronze statue on Wall Street in New York City that symbolizes a strong financial market. 
    3. David is a Renaissance sculpture in Florence, Italy, by legendary artist Michelangelo.
    4. Lincoln Memorial is a statue of Abraham Lincoln in Washington, D.C., at the U.S. capitol. 
    5. The Manneken Pis fountain sculpture in Brussels features a puer mingens, a naked boy urinating into the fountain’s basin, in what has become a whimsical symbol of Belgium. 
    6. Venus de Milo is an ancient sculpture located at the Louvre Museum in Paris believed to depict Aphrodite, the Greek goddess of love. 
    7. The Thinker is a famous philosophical statue of a thinking man by Auguste Rodin in Paris, France. 
    8. Pieta is an Italian Renaissance sculpture created by Michelangelo Buonarroti in St. Peter’s Basilica, Vatican City. 
    9. Little Mermaid is a bronze statue of a mermaid located in Copenhagen, Denmark.
    10. The Great Sphinx is a symbol of ancient Egypt that depicts a sphinx located in Giza, Egypt.

    The top 10 most popular lakes in the world include:

    1. Lake Como in northern Italy offers breathtaking views of the Alps and Renaissance-era architecture in the nearby villages of Bellagio and Como.
    2. Lake Garda is a popular vacation destination in Italy that features water sports and family-friendly activities.
    3. Lake Geneva in the northern Alps serves up stunning mountain views and luxury shopping, spas, and upscale resorts.
    4. Lake Zurich in Switzerland features serene mountain views in the Alps as well as water sports and proximity to nearby attractions in the city of Zurich.
    5. Lake Lucerne in central Switzerland is nestled in the Alps and borders the town of Lucerne, which includes medieval architecture.
    6. Lake Michigan borders Illinois, Michigan, and Wisconsin in the U.S. and includes 26 miles of shoreline along the city of Chicago, including beaches, waterfront paths, and Navy Pier.
    7. Lake Maggiore offers beautiful mountain views along the southern Alps in Italy and Switzerland.
    8. Lake Constance at the foot of the Alps borders Germany, Austria, and Switzerland and offers sailing, windsurfing, swimming, and serene natural views.
    9. Loch Ness in Scotland features stunning views and beautiful hiking as well as legendary tales of the Loch Ness Monster.
    10. Lake Bled located in Slovenia in the Julian Alps features breathtaking views and medieval history.

    The top 10 snorkeling destinations in the world according to Visited include:

    1. Cancun, Mexico is the most popular snorkeling destination, with expansive coral reefs and a wide variety of marine life in the Caribbean.
    2. Bali, Indonesia has beautiful beaches and hundreds of different marine species. Bali is part of the Coral Triangle, which has 75 percent of the world’s marine life, with almost 600 species.
    3. Cozumel, Mexico offers abundant coral reefs in the warm waters of the Caribbean. 
    4. Great Barrier Reef, Australia has the world’s largest coral reef and is one of the Seven Natural Wonders of the World.
    5. Phuket, Thailand has crystal-clear waters and ample marine life for snorkeling. 
    6. Florida Keys, United States features pristine waters and beautiful snorkeling opportunities. 
    7. Red Sea is a saltwater inlet of the Indian Ocean with clear reefs and plentiful sea life for snorkeling off the coast of Egypt.
    8. California, United States features 840 miles (1,352 km) of stunning coastline with snorkeling in many places, including Glass Beach and Monterey.
    9. Cenotes, Mexico has thousands of cenotes – deep water wells – with beautiful snorkeling off the coast of the Yucatan Peninsula.
    10. Phi Phi Islands, Thailand is a group of 6 islands with clear waters and a wide range of marine life that are part of the Coral Triangle.
